Wheels on the Bus


A fund to bring Wake County students to area arts and cultural destinations!

The Wheels on the Bus Fund covers transportation and admission costs for one grade level per school annually at Wake County Title I public elementary schools for field trips to area arts and cultural destinations.

Schools must choose their field trip destination from a list of available options. Field trips must take place during the school day.  Schools may submit only one application per school year.

Updates for the 2024-25 School Year

For next school year, we are offering the following three options:

  • 2nd graders may see Carolina Ballet’s Nutcracker on Friday, December 13, 2024
  • 3rd graders may visit the North Carolina Museum of Art between October 2024 and April 2025
  • 5th graders may see Raleigh Little Theatre’s School House Rock on Wednesday, May 7, 2025

The fund will cover transportation and admission costs for one grade-level field trip.

An online application will be available in August. As a limited numbers of seats will be available for each field trip, and we’re only able to award a single trip per school, schools will have the option of ranking their preferences in the application.

Funds will be awarded on a rolling basis, first come first served, until November 1, 2024 for the 2024-25 school year.

Why is there no 4th grade option? All WCPSS 4th graders already attend a performance of the North Carolina Symphony, so this funding opportunity makes an arts field trip available to other grade levels.
